To provide for reconciliation pursuant to title II of S. Con. Res. 5.
Sponsor and status
John Yarmuth
Sponsor. Representative for Kentucky's 3rd congressional district. Democrat.
117th Congress (2021–2023)
Enacted — Signed by the President on Mar 11, 2021
This bill was enacted after being signed by the President on March 11, 2021.

Incorporated legislation
This bill incorporates provisions from:
S. 263: Worker Health Coverage Protection Act
Introduced on Feb 4, 2021. 33%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 423: Emergency Pension Plan Relief Act of 2021
Introduced on Jan 21, 2021. 31%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 409: Emergency Pension Plan Relief Act of 2021
Introduced on Jan 21, 2021. 28%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 637: Veterans Economic Recovery Act of 2021
Introduced on Feb 1, 2021. 59% incorporated. (compare text)
S. 134: A bill to direct the Secretary of Veterans Affairs to carry out a retraining assistance program for unemployed veterans, and for other purposes.
Introduced on Jan 28, 2021. 50%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 1669: State Small Business Credit Initiative Renewal Act
Introduced on Mar 9, 2021. 48%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 926: To provide emergency funding for home visiting programs during the pandemic, and for other purposes.
Introduced on Feb 8, 2021. 73% incorporated. (compare text)
S. 639: Grandfamilies Technical Assistance Center Act
Introduced on Mar 9, 2021. 90%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 1683: To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to exclude certain student loan forgiveness from gross income.
Introduced on Mar 9, 2021. 100% incorporated. (compare text)
S. 149: A bill to amend title XI of the Social Security Act to provide Secretarial authority to temporarily waive or modify application of certain Medicare requirements with respect to ambulance services ...
Introduced on Feb 2, 2021. 99%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 1139: Feeding Homeless Youth During COVID–19 Act
Introduced on Feb 18, 2021. 100% incorporated. (compare text)
H.R. 942: To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to provide for the application of the premium tax credit in the case of certain individuals who are unemployed during 2021.
Introduced on Feb 8, 2021. 100% incorporated. (compare text)
History
H.R. 1319 is a bill in the United States Congress.
A bill must be passed by both the House and Senate in identical form and then be signed by the President to become law.
Bills numbers restart every two years. That means there are other bills with the number H.R. 1319. This is the one from the 117th Congress.
